centos改mac地址
时间: 2024-06-12 18:02:31 浏览: 69
在CentOS系统下,你可以通过`ifconfig`命令来修改网卡的MAC地址。这里有两个命令行示例:
1. 使用`ifconfig`命令直接修改MAC地址[^1]:
```bash
[root@localhost ~]# ifconfig eth0 hw ether 新的MAC地址
```
其中,"新的MAC地址"应替换为你想要设置的新MAC地址,格式通常是十六进制,例如`00:AA:BB:CC:DD:EE`。
2. 或者,如果你使用的是较新的系统,`ifconfig`可能已被`ip`命令替代,可以使用下面的方法:
```bash
[root@localhost ~]# ip link set dev eth0 address 新的MAC地址
```
同样,将"新的MAC地址"替换为实际的MAC地址。
请注意,修改MAC地址可能会影响网络连接,所以在执行此操作之前,最好先备份当前的MAC地址,并确保你知道自己在做什么。此外,一些网络设备可能会锁定MAC地址,不允许随意更改。
相关问题
centos修改ip地址和mac地址
要在CentOS上修改IP地址和MAC地址,您可以按照以下步骤进行操作:
1. 查看网络接口:运行命令 `ifconfig` 或 `ip addr`,以获取当前的网络接口信息。找到您想要修改的接口的名称(一般是 `eth0` 或 `ensXX`)。
2. 关闭网络接口:运行命令 `sudo ifdown <interface_name>`,将网络接口关闭。例如,如果要关闭 `eth0`,则运行 `sudo ifdown eth0`。
3. 修改IP地址:运行命令 `sudo vi /etc/sysconfig/network-scripts/ifcfg-<interface_name>`,用文本编辑器打开网络配置文件。将文件中的 `IPADDR` 和 `NETMASK` 字段修改为您想要的新IP地址和子网掩码。
4. 修改MAC地址:运行命令 `sudo vi /etc/sysconfig/network-scripts/ifcfg-<interface_name>`,用文本编辑器打开网络配置文件。将文件中的 `HWADDR` 字段修改为您想要的新MAC地址。
5. 保存并退出编辑器。
6. 启用网络接口:运行命令 `sudo ifup <interface_name>`,将网络接口重新启用。例如,如果要启用 `eth0`,则运行 `sudo ifup eth0`。
7. 重启网络服务:运行命令 `sudo systemctl restart network.service`,以使更改生效。
请注意,修改IP地址和MAC地址可能会导致网络连接中断,请确保在远程服务器上操作时有备用连接。此外,更改MAC地址可能会违反网络管理员的政策,因此请在确保合规性的情况下进行更改。
Centos 修改mac
在CentOS 7中,你可以通过编辑`/etc/sysconfig/network-scripts/ifcfg-ens160`(假设你的网络接口名为ens160)来修改MAC地址[^1]。具体步骤如下:
1. 打开终端并以管理员权限执行:
```bash
sudo nano /etc/sysconfig/network-scripts/ifcfg-ens160
```
2. 在打开的文件中找到`HWADDR`行,它通常用于指定MAC地址。默认情况下可能看起来像这样:
```
HWADDR=00:16:3e:xx:yy:zz
```
3. 替换`xx:yy:zz`为你想要的新MAC地址。例如,如果你想要修改为`AA:BB:CC:DD:EE:FF`,则改为:
```
HWADDR=AA:BB:CC:DD:EE:FF
```
4. 保存并关闭文件。按`Ctrl + X`,然后输入`Y`确认保存,接着按回车。
5. 刷新网络配置使其生效:
```bash
service network restart
```
完成上述步骤后,你的MAC地址就已成功修改为新的值[^2]。
阅读全文